Output 58d644f496c0a180210e3d5d442e504fd71ba84a612c2317db392d250d6b9c17:1

value
39230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a7c8bc7ae30a5241393e2ff70f305dfa10640b4 OP_EQUAL
address
3FmsBhEbNfRKLtxUPha1cX9tYQnw4QUpgV
transaction
58d644f496c0a180210e3d5d442e504fd71ba84a612c2317db392d250d6b9c17
spent
true